物聯方案
2024年04月27日
5. 數據分片與分區:
對數據庫進行分片,將數據分布到不同的服務器上。通過數據分區,可以將熱點數據與冷數據分開處理,優化性能。
6. 服務的微服務化:
將系統拆分成多個微服務,每個服務負責系統的一部分功能。這種架構可以讓系統更容易擴展和維護,并且可以在不同的服務之間進行負載均衡。
7. 硬件資源擴展:
根據需求增加服務器的CPU、內存和存儲資源。云服務平臺(如AWS、Azure)提供了彈性伸縮服務,可以根據實際需求自動調整資源。
8. 優化數據查詢和索引:
對數據庫進行性能優化,如合理設計索引,優化查詢語句,減少全表掃描等,可以顯著提高查詢效率。
9. 監控和預警系統:
建立完善的監控系統,實時監控流量和性能狀況,及時發現并解決問題。使用預警機制可以在系統即將達到負載極限時提前做出響應。
通過上述策略的組合使用,可以有效解決車輛定位系統在面對高并發時的各種挑戰,保證系統的穩定運行和高效處理能力。
轉自:互聯網